Objectives:
•    Build foundational to advanced proficiency in PowerPoint, Excel, and MS Project
•    Learn how to integrate Microsoft 365 Copilot for productivity, reporting, and automation
•    Enhance communication, analysis, and planning using AI and Microsoft Office suite

Course Outline:

Day 1: PowerPoint – From Basics to Storytelling with Copilot

A. PowerPoint Basics

  • Navigating the interface and creating slides
  • Slide layouts, design themes, and text formatting
  • Inserting images, shapes, icons, and multimedia

B. Intermediate Techniques

  • Slide Master and reusable templates
  • Charts, SmartArt, and tables
  • Transitions, animations, and timing

C. PowerPoint with Copilot (Intro)

  • Overview of Copilot in PowerPoint
  • Generating presentations from prompts
  • Editing and summarizing content using Copilot

Day 2: Excel – From Spreadsheet Basics to Advanced Analytics

A. Excel Basics

  • Workbook structure and navigation
  • Cell formatting, formulas, and functions (SUM, AVERAGE, etc.)
  • Sorting, filtering, and basic charts

B. Intermediate to Advanced Excel

  • Logical functions (IF, AND, OR), lookup functions (VLOOKUP, XLOOKUP)
  • PivotTables and PivotCharts
  • Conditional formatting and data validation
  • Named ranges and dynamic formulas

C. Excel with Copilot (Intro–Intermediate)

  • Using natural language to analyze data
  • Generating charts and summaries with Copilot
  • Identifying trends and automating repetitive tasks

Day 3: Microsoft Project – From Planning to Execution

A. MS Project Basics

  • Interface overview and starting a new project
  • Setting start/end dates, calendars, and dependencies
  • Task types: Manual vs. Auto scheduling

B. Intermediate MS Project

  • Creating and managing Work Breakdown Structures (WBS)
  • Assigning resources and managing costs
  • Setting baselines, critical path, and project tracking

C. Project Reporting and Export

  • Custom and graphical reports
  • Exporting data to Excel and PowerPoint
  • Preparing reports for stakeholders

Day 4: Microsoft Copilot Deep Dive –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Teams

A. What is Microsoft 365 Copilot?

  • Copilot ecosystem: where and how it works
  • Prompt best practices: writing, refining, and troubleshooting
  • Privacy, access, and data governance considerations

B. Copilot in Action

  • Drafting emails and summaries in Outlook
  • Creating reports and content in Word
  • AI-driven dashboards and what-if analysis in Excel
  • AI-enhanced slide creation and edits in PowerPoint
  • Meeting summaries, action items, and chat help in Teams

C. Use Cases and Scenarios

  • Time-saving workflows for team leaders, analysts, and project managers
  • AI-powered content creation across apps
  • Cross-app data integration and reporting
